When James Merlin Bellows was born on 11 October 1849, in Honey Creek, Pottawattamie, Iowa, United States, his father, John Ferguson Bellows, was 24 and his mother, Marrilla Marily Plumb, was 15. He lived in Utah, Utah, United States in 1850. He died on 16 October 1850, in Provo, Utah, Utah, United States, at the age of 1, and was buried in Payson City Cemetery, Payson, Utah, Utah, United States.

English: metonymic occupational name for a maker or user of bellows, a plural variant of Bellow 1.
Americanized form of French Béland (see Beland ), with the addition of excrescent -s, a common feature of Americanized surnames.
In some cases also an Americanized form of Jewish (eastern Ashkenazic) Belous .
Dictionary of American Family Names © Patrick Hanks 2003, 2006.
